Output acdbf633865f1460328ef52e17eac25727575153672fec1f2aca0e6e425a7db1:0

value
10518800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 377e3ec81ade9b9377c5976edfc8646409418877 OP_EQUAL
address
36kSKmUFqRchcokkVByuycji26u5rDaxQP
transaction
acdbf633865f1460328ef52e17eac25727575153672fec1f2aca0e6e425a7db1
confirmations
249183
spent
true